Foundation moisture prevention services focus on protecting a building’s foundation from excess water and humidity that can cause damage over time. These services typically involve installing or upgrading systems designed to manage groundwater and surface water around a property. Solutions may include exterior drainage systems, such as French drains or sump pump installations, as well as interior moisture barriers and vapor barriers that help control humidity levels inside the basement or crawl space. The goal is to create a dry, stable environment that minimizes the risk of water infiltration, mold growth, and structural deterioration.
These services are especially valuable for addressing common problems like persistent dampness, musty odors, or visible water stains on basement walls and floors. Excess moisture can weaken foundation materials, promote mold growth, and lead to cracks or shifting in the structure over time. The overview below groups typical Foundation Moisture Prevention proj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Owensboro, KY.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or moisture prevention fixes, such as sealing cracks or installing vapor barriers, range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le band, depending on the scope of work and materials needed.
Moderate Projects - more extensive moisture control solutions, including foundation waterproofing or drainage improvements, generally cost between $1,000-$3,500. These projects are common for homeowners seeking to address ongoing moisture issues.
Major Renovations - larger, more complex moisture prevention systems, such as interior drainage or foundation repairs, can reach $4,000-$8,000 or more. Fewer projects push into this high tier, typically for significant structural concerns.
Full Foundation Replacement - complete foundation replacement or major structural overhaul might exceed $15,000, with costs varying based on size and complexity. Such extensive work is less common but necessary for severe foundation damage or persistent moisture problems.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es foundation moisture problems? Moisture issues in foundations often result from poor drainage, high soil water content, or inadequate grading around the property.
How can foundation moisture be prevented? Local contractors may recommend proper drainage systems, waterproofing membranes, and soil grading to reduce excess moisture around the foundation.
What signs indicate foundation moisture issues? Signs include damp basement walls, mold growth, musty odors, or visible water stains on interior surfaces.
Are there specific solutions for preventing moisture in basements? Yes, professionals often install sump pumps, vapor barriers, and exterior waterproofing to manage basement moisture levels.
How do local service providers assess foundation moisture concerns? They typically perform visual inspections and may use moisture meters to identify problem areas and recommend appropriate solutions.
